Hello there,
My mother bought a 1996 (N) Discovery today, privately, and on the way home she noticed that when changing from 1st gear to 2nd gear there is a crunch and it snatches into gear. Going from 3rd to 2nd does not do this.
I presume this is a problem with the syncro between 1st and 2nd, but have no real idea about Landy's, so thought you guys could advise.
Is this going to be terminal, or is it just an annoying feature that we should get used to?

1st to 2nd can be a problem if you do a quick change as you would in a normal car. If you hesitate very briefly between the two when the gear stick is in neutral it should be smooth.I presume this is a problem with the syncro between 1st and 2nd, but have no real idea about Landy's, so thought you guys could advise.
If the previous owners have done the same as your mum is then it can lead to wear...
I have a TD200 which I think has the same box. It does the same plus when it is hot it sometimes wont go into second at all. It is the sychro hubs going or gone, I just double de-clutch and it doesn't crunch. Mines been like it for a good few months and is steadily getting worse. I've had a reasonable quote from a freind who runs a gearbx and clutch repair company but I'm waiting till the clutch or box die before I get it done.

Sadly this is a common fault with them. BTW the 200 Tdi has the LT77 gearbox and the 300 Tdi R380. I use Ashcroft in Luton and found them to be very good www.ashcroft-transmissions.co.uk

If it only crunches from first to second then thats GOOD-ive had some that crunch in every gear!They all do it eventually.I took a 200tdi in px for another car I was selling a few months ago with a crunching box so I sourced a good secondhand one off ebay for £120 and had a local mechanic fit it for £150.Swapping gearboxes over on discoverys is not an easy job,its fiddly and the gearbox unit itself is very heavy.

i can vouch for that having changed an auto box on a V8 three times. i know its not a LR but my transit also crunches from 1st to 2nd but not 3rd to 2nd and it is much worse than cold. it isn't a problem for now, just be slow and gentle with the gear changes and it should last for a while whilst you save up the money for a reccon box and fitting.it's a common fault...if it's a Tdi there's little point in revving past 3000rpm in first which should help. There's a bit of a knack to a smooth change, I find that going 1st-neutral-a teeny bit into 2nd-back to neutral-into 2nd properly but all in a blink of an eye will give you a smooth change every time.
